Spent the day at an absolutely soaking wet Donington yesterday.
Very enjoyable day and a pretty big crowd until mid afternoon.
The mini's were a good bit of fun to watch.
The Legends were great - really enjoyed them - Great series, great racing.
The Pickups - a little disappointed with them to be honest - nowhere near as much close racing as I expected.
Britcar - 1st race on Sunday was brilliant - it coincided with the start of the really heavy rain - so despite the race including an Aquis supercar, an Evo 9, a Boxster, two Marcos Mantis, a Golf, a Sagaris an M3 and a Lambo - what I expected to turn into a procession of a variety of different cars strung out around the track turned into a very exciting race.
Possibly a little too long at 45 minutes but great fun to watch the Evo lead in the wet, the Aquis fly round at stupid speeds before exiting into the gravel, and the Golf duelling with the Sagaris before the Lambo took the win.
The first truck race was sadly cut short by three red flags, several accidents and finally a driver being taken to hospital - but it was great to see and feel the huge things racing round!
For 15 quid a head what a great day out.
